It’s gala night in Kincardine.
Chamber of Commerce Community Achievement awards will be handed out to eleven winners tonight at a big celebration.
The winners were announced and notified last month.
Among the honourees; Jennifer Webb, as the Citizen of the Year, Crabby Joe’s as Business of the year and Anderkin Foods as the Farming Related Business of the Year.

The celebration takes place tonight at the Best Western Governor’s Inn, Kincardine.
Award Winners:
Bruce Power Citizen of the Year – Jennifer Webb
Canadian Tire Farm Business/Farm Related Business of the Year – Anderkin Foods
Herbal Magic’s Business of the Year — Crabby Joe’s of Kincardine
Bruce Telecom Customer Service Excellence — Kwik Way of Tiverton
Municipality of Kincardine New Business Award — Nine Waves of Kincardine
Enbridge Quality of Life — The Day Away Program of Kincardine
OPG Environmental — Ainsdale Golf Course
Kinfarm Tire Young Entrepreneur of the Year — Matt Cottrill
Meridian Lifetime Achievement — Doug Storrey
Nuclear Waste Management Organization Award of Merit — Amy Snobelen & Kathy Hackney
Superheat Business Person of the Year — Mike Brough
